What Is the Key to Success?

During a recent trip to Florida to participate as a judge in the North American Intercollegiate Dairy Challenge contest, my wife and I had a unique experience. On the way to Florida, we stayed in the Nashville, Tennessee area and were on our way out of our hotel when we faced a daunting challenge.

As we were entering the elevator from our third-floor room, she handed me the car keys and suggested that I should drive. That was great, except during the handoff, we didn’t quite connect, and the keys went sliding across the hallway. In fact, it was worse than you might imagine.

The keys slid across the hallway and fell down the elevator shaft. Oops! First, the good news – we had a second set of car keys with us, so we were not “car disabled” for four days. However, my Bride quickly reminded me that our house keys were on that set of keys, along with her nice leather key FOB that we had purchased during a trip to Italy…

Please recall that in prior blogs I have advised you to first outline the objective – in this case, recover the keys.

Then, identify the hurdles and find ways to get around them:

·       Hurdle #1 – It was Sunday afternoon, and no elevator company is open on Sunday, so we talked with the Hotel Manager and were advised that the maintenance man might be helpful.

·       Hurdle #2 – The maintenance man was off until Tuesday… Our solution was to talk with him ASAP Tuesday morning. Unfortunately, he had car problems and came in later than usual. Eventually, he was unable to assist us…

·       Hurdle #3 – While constantly checking with the Manager each day, no one had any suggestions or results for us. Remember – Stay the Course!

·       Hurdle #4 – We asked the Manager Wednesday morning if she had heard back from the elevator company. She claimed she had never said she would call the elevator company, but “Let me check with them today.” Sheesh…

·       Hurdle #5 – We needed to head to Florida for the contest I was supposed to judge. Our departure was scheduled for Thursday morning…

·       Hurdle #6 – In response to our request, the Manager said getting the elevator company to come out and recover the keys from the elevator shaft may cost up to $300. Ouch! However, we reasoned, it might cost that much to duplicate our car key and change the door locks on our house.

·       Hurdle #7 – Always the waiting! We set out and took care of other business that was necessary that day. We felt we had initiated the necessary steps to reach a successful outcome.

Lo and behold. When we returned to our hotel on Wednesday evening around 6 pm, the keys were in an envelope at the front desk with no charge from the elevator company. Wow!

What was the key to our success? Perseverance. Even when we had doubts, we stayed on the task at hand, and kindness & success eventually prevailed. The same holds true for you and your business endeavors. Stay focused. Stay engaged with your goal, and you will get there!
